US Virtualized Evolved Packet Core Market Summary

As per Market Research Future analysis, the US virtualized evolved-packet-core market Size was estimated at 676.8 USD Million in 2024. The US virtualized evolved-packet-core market is projected to grow from 889.65 USD Million in 2025 to 13700.0 USD Million by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 31.4%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035

Focus on Network Slicing

Network slicing is emerging as a critical trend in the virtualized evolved-packet-core market. This approach allows operators to create multiple virtual networks on a single physical infrastructure, tailored to specific service requirements. By implementing network slicing, providers can optimize resource allocation and improve service quality, catering to diverse customer needs.

US Virtualized Evolved Packet Core Market Drivers

Rising Adoption of 5G Technology

The rollout of 5G technology in the US is a significant catalyst for the virtualized evolved-packet-core market. As telecom operators prepare for the deployment of 5G networks, the need for a flexible and scalable core network becomes paramount. Virtualized evolved-packet-core solutions are well-suited to support the high data rates and low latency requirements of 5G applications. Industry analysts predict that the 5G market will reach a valuation of over $300 billion by 2025, driving substantial investments in virtualized core technologies. This trend indicates a robust growth trajectory for the virtualized evolved-packet-core market as operators seek to leverage the benefits of 5G.

Cost Efficiency and Operational Flexibility

Cost efficiency remains a crucial factor driving the virtualized evolved-packet-core market. By adopting virtualized solutions, telecom operators can significantly reduce operational costs associated with traditional hardware. The transition to software-based architectures allows for more agile and flexible network management, enabling providers to scale services according to demand. Reports suggest that companies can achieve up to 30% savings in operational expenditures by implementing virtualized systems. This financial incentive, combined with the ability to quickly adapt to changing market conditions, positions the virtualized evolved-packet-core market as an attractive option for service providers aiming to optimize their resources and enhance service delivery.

Industry Developments

The US Virtualized Evolved Packet Core Market is witnessing significant developments, particularly with major players like Intel Corporation, Mavenir, and Dell Technologies making strides in innovation and deployment. In September 2023, Mavenir secured a partnership with Nokia to enhance cloud-native packet core solutions, potentially accelerating 5G expansion. In August 2023, Cisco Systems announced an upgrade to its Evolved Packet Core platform aiming to enhance security features and operational efficiencies for telecom operators.

Furthermore, Oracle Corporation and Amazon Web Services made headlines by launching a joint initiative in July 2023 focusing on 5G and edge computing, which may reshape service delivery models. In the mergers and acquisitions landscape, TCS announced its acquisition of a prominent U.S. tech firm in July 2023 to strengthen its cloud services in the telecom sector. Over the past few years, the market has shown remarkable growth, driven by the increasing demand for high-speed internet and mobile connectivity, with a significant surge in market valuation attributed to technological advancements and the rollout of 5G networks.
